Originally Posted by hakes
Can anyone confirm that it starts the car in 2nd? If so, does that mean when you stop the car stays in 2nd and does not downshift to 1st?

I am attempting to troubleshoot something and knowing this information about Snow Mode would be of much help. Thank you.

unless i have a freak GS400 i can confirm that it DOES NOT start the car in 2nd. in my car snow mode deadens throttle response [a LOT!]. it doesnt lock out 1st gear. when accelerating from a stop in snow mode using e-shift at 2, i see the RPMs drop signifying a gear change from 1 to 2. with the e-shift at 2, it'll sit in 2nd gear all day. until you stop. then it'll go back to one, wind out, and shift ever so smoothly into 2nd. the car does feel like very lazy thereby making it feel like its starting out in 2nd.
